If I can give this Bakery 10000 stars I would. They did my cake for my wedding and hands down the best cake us and the 200 people at our wedding ever had. The staff at LA Banker went way beyond what we expected. They were so professional and where we thought we were going to spend $1,500 for a cake it was $450 for a three tier cake unheard of. They came to the terrace on the park set up the entire cake and decorated it there. It just looked incredible. What a beautiful experience we had with them and I can’t talk enough about about them so to the staff at LA Baker your the best and thank you for the beautiful wedding cake.

Very nice selection of pastries presented, very neat and clean interior. I ordered the biskoff cheesecake, I was considering the raspberry tart. Each item has a description of the major ingredients which I liked. Would’ve ordered the dulce de leche minus the Carmel if they had it.
The cheesecake is tasty, not overly sweet or dense. Would’ve loved for more crunch in the cake crust; otherwise, great product.
Not the friendliest service but not rude either. Possibly would return. Paid a little over 9 dollars so I’d say the value for quality/quantity is ok.
